Jeremy Lapoint’s dad is in prison and Mom barely scrapes by. Suddenly though, he can fly, pass through walls, meets his guardian angel, and learns that he’s a Nephilim—part human, part angel. He enrolls in a school for teens like him where Director Louisa Prouse lectures that they’ve attained humanity’s next level of development. When Jeremy counters that they’re half angel, he must battle Prouse and a demon army who oppose the truth that angels—and God—are real.

Tavern Puzzles® are reproductions of a type of puzzle traditionally forged by blacksmiths to amuse their friends at country taverns and inns. Keeping with tradition, a museum-trained blacksmith from Long Island has reproduced some of these antique designs as well as his own original designs. All the puzzles are handcrafted and individually assembled. Each puzzle is mechanical in nature; removal of the object piece does not rely on force or trickery.
